The 2004 Britannia Coin series represents a highly collectable year within The Royal Mint’s Britannia programme, featuring strong demand across both gold proof issues and silver bullion Britannia coins. By 2004, Britannia had become a firmly established global investment coin, recognised within both the UK collector market and international bullion sector.

Struck in traditional 22-carat gold, the 2004 Britannia gold coins continue the long-standing early-series specification, while the 1oz silver Britannia coins in .958 fine silver remain a core bullion issue, widely collected for their intrinsic metal content and classic Philip Nathan design.

The 2004 issue is particularly notable for its limited mintage gold proof coins, with select denominations such as the 1oz gold Britannia struck in extremely low numbers (around 973 worldwide), making it a key modern scarcity issue within the series.

The 2004 Britannia coins continue the established 22-carat gold standard, while the silver issues are struck in Britannia silver (.958 fineness), weighing 1 troy ounce (31.1g of pure silver content) with a 40mm diameter, maintaining the traditional large-format Britannia design used across the modern series.

Silver Britannias from 2004 were issued in both bullion uncirculated and proof finishes, with bullion examples produced at approximately 100,000 mintage, making them widely available but still strongly collected as part of full year runs.

As a mid-2000s key Britannia issue, the 2004 Britannia remains highly desirable among collectors building complete date sets, with strong demand for both gold proof sets and standard silver Britannia bullion coins, particularly in certified high-grade condition.
